Quick Facts:

  • We are ACGME accredited and have Osteopathic recognition by the ACGME, 

  • We accept a class of 10 new residents each year and strive to balance taking 5 MDs and 5 DOs each year

  • We have two clinical sites. One in the rural town of Mason, MI and one near the state capitol in Lansing, MI.  Residents are given their choice of preferred clinical site during their intern year and are then assigned a patient panel in that clinic.

  • We have an Obstetrics Track for residents who are  interested in pregnancy care and would like more experience during their three years.

  • We have associated fellowship in Sports Medicine.

  • We are an integrated care setting which offers inter-professional collaboration with behavioral health and pharmacy professionals to provide holistic care to our family medicine patients.

Eligibility Requirements for Applicants:

  • We only accept applications through ERAS.  Applications can be found at: https://apps.aamc.org/myeras-web/#/landing

  • Our institution sponsors J-1 visas 

  • We require 3 letters of recommendation

  • Applicant must have graduated from a medical school approved for licensure in all fifty states

  • The strongest consideration and preference will be given to applicants who have

    • graduated from medical school within the last 2-5 years and/or had continuous clinical experience in the 22 months prior to application 

    • no fails or only one fail on Steps 1, 2 or 3

    • Minimum scores expected

      • Step 2 USMLE >= 235

      • Step 2 COMLEX >= 435  

 

About interviews:

  • Invitations to interview will be sent via e-mail so please check both your ERAS e-mail as well as the e-mail address listed on your application.

  • Interviews are held from October to December each year.

  • All candidates will meet with our Program Director or Associate Program Director as well as a variety of attendings and current residents in the program.

  • Interviews will be conducted in a hybrid format with both virtual and in person options offered, if selected you will receive more information about your options for scheduling your interview.
